## Who to ping about GiftNote

Welcome aboard! GiftNote is our donation-receipt mailer for the Larchfield Fund. Template tweaks go to the comms folks; delivery failures and bounce weirdness go to the platform crew. Don't push template changes on Fridays — receipts batch over the weekend. For anything GiftNote-related, start with the address below.

billing contact of kaweg-tajeg = drudor.lamion.oliath@torvalabs.test

Finance Review Summary — Large-Deal Discount Policy

Quarterly review of Corvane Analytics' discount policy shows deals above the large-deal threshold averaging 22% discounts, against a 18% guideline. Margin erosion is concentrated in the Westerly region. Approval thresholds will tighten next quarter, with deal-desk sign-off mandatory above 20%. The attached confidential note summarises the business plans informing these changes.

management briefing: Project Ulavan slips by two quarters because of the staffing delay.

## Migration Step 4: Weather-Alert Fan-Out

In this step you move the Stormlace fan-out worker from the legacy queue to the new topic-based dispatcher. Support should expect a short window (under five minutes) where alerts for the Vellbrook region are delayed but not dropped; they are buffered and replayed in order once the dispatcher confirms its subscriptions. Before cutting over, confirm the buffer directory is writable and the retry ceiling matches production norms. Apply the following configuration to the new worker.

service settings:
[casax]
port = 6379
team = rusir
host = casax.zemvarhq.corp
region = outer-4
access_code = ac_9808ce
timeout_ms = 1500